pyveth - veth driver for Docker Engine written in Python
Jacek Kowalski
yesterday 5687c6c38c48c23d03073b45e065aeb9b36873ae
lib/NetworkDriverData.py
@@ -1,6 +1,18 @@
import shelve
from typing import Dict
from docker_plugin_api.NetworkDriverEntities import NetworkCreateEntity, EndpointCreateEntity
networks : Dict[str, NetworkCreateEntity] = {}
endpoints : Dict[str, EndpointCreateEntity] = {}
networks_store = shelve.open('networks', writeback=True)
networks: Dict[str, NetworkCreateEntity] = networks_store
def networks_sync():
    networks_store.sync()
endpoints: Dict[str, EndpointCreateEntity] = {}
__all__ = ['endpoints', 'networks', 'networks_sync']